I would like to thank the Industrial Engineering Student Chapter at Wayne State University and Dr. Frank Plonka (IE Department Head) for hosting me at their September meeting. It was great to see all the enthusiasm with the student industrial engineers. During the meeting, I reviewed all the support the Senior Chapter provides to our IE student chapters (scholarships, conference support, community service activities, meeting discounts, etc.) and received good feedback and interest from the audience. I met many students from this group at the May IE conference in Orlando. They have many great ideas, and I look forward to them providing many great ideas and energy for the Detroit Chapter and to IIE.

Looking forward, I am encouraged by the work that has been done by the current Detroit Chapter Board of Directors. We have an award winning newsletter, a good website which is generating some traffic and is helping our members get current information about chapter operations and activities. I believe that we have increased our contact with the membership with email notification of monthly meetings and special events. Our Chapter has won Silver and Gold award with the national organization for our operating parameters – which tells us that we are focusing on the right things to support our members.
